STROKE'S SEAFOOD

2745 N OSPREY AVE, SARASOTA, FL 34234

License #6805681

🦞 Seafood ℹ️ Categories are auto-assigned based on restaurant names and may not be 100% accurate
Quick take

STROKE'S SEAFOOD in SARASOTA currently holds an InspectFL Health Score of 93 out of 100 — a B grade — generally clean with some minor or moderate violations on record. This restaurant has 2 inspections on record from Florida DBPR, with the most recent inspection on December 2, 2025. Across those visits, inspectors documented 13 total violations — 4 critical, 4 major, 5 minor.

Inspection timeline

Inspection History

Read the newest inspection first, then scan for patterns. Repeated high-priority findings matter more than one isolated bad day.

Critical Major Minor

Inspector notes are being added across all restaurants. Some inspections may only show violation codes until notes are available.

  • Disposition: Inspection Completed - No Further Action
  • [31A-07-4] Handwash sink missing in warewashing or food preparation area. Observed a hand sink missing from the ware washing area.
  • [50-17-3] Operating with an expired Division of Hotels and Restaurants license. Observed their license expired 12/1/25
  • [51-09-4] Establishment did not report seating change that affects the license fee, Clean Indoor Air Act, sewage system approval or other related requirements. Operator has stated he is attempting to have the form signed but is having issues with the authority in charge.
  • [06-09-1] Commercially processed reduced oxygen packaged fish bearing a label indicating that it is to remain frozen until time of use no longer frozen and not removed from reduced oxygen package. Observed two filets of commercially reduced oxygen packaged fish not removed from its packaging before thawed. Operator willingly set them aside for disposal.
  • [25-05-4] Single-service articles improperly stored. Observed a case of packaged to-go containers stored on the floor of the kitchen. Operator put them on a shelf.
  • [01B-13-4] Stop Sale issued due to food not being in a wholesome, sound condition. Observed two filets of commercially reduced oxygen packaged fish not removed from its packaging before thawed. Operator willingly set them aside for disposal.
  • [08A-05-6] Raw animal food stored over/not properly separated from ready-to-eat food. Observed a container of raw fish stored over packaged butter in their reach in cooler. Operator switched the products.
  • [31B-06-4] Soap dispenser at handwash sink not working/unable to dispense soap. Observed the soap dispenser not functioning. Operator replaced the batteries.
